Men, as they age, commonly experience hair loss. It can occur due to genetics, hormones, and environmental factors. The primary cause of male hair loss is androgenic alopecia, also known as male pattern baldness. It is an inherited condition that is responsible for 95 per cent of hair loss in men, giving them a receding hairline and thinning crown. Genetically, it is because there is a sensitivity to a byproduct of testosterone called dihydrotestosterone (DHT). This sensitivity is reflected in a shrinking of hair follicles, which impedes hair growth.
